Vine-environment relationship on the development of aromatic compounds in native Muscats from Istria, Croatia

Monoterpens are very important flavors in vine of muscat cultivars. These compounds are already present in grapes, and their amount, profile and proportion are responsabile for aromatic characteristics in grape and vine. They are present as free terpens (FT) and bond terpens (BD). In the literature also, FT existing as FVT (free volatile terpens) and BD existing as PVT (potentially volatile terpens or glycosidically bond terpens). Monoterpens are synthesized during berry maturation and their concentration in grapes depends on various factors such as cultivar, viticultural practices, region, climatic conditions and moment of harvest. This investigation has encompassed two native cultivars in Croatia, on two locations (Porec and Umag) of Istrian peninsula. Those were Rose Muscat (red) and Momian Muscat (white). Our initial hypothesis was that ambiental factors could impact the development of terpene compounds. Our aims were: a) investigated of terpene characteristics of Istrian native muscats, b) difference inside microlocation on the aroma development – case of Rose muscat, c) difference between microlocation on the aroma development – case of Momian muscat and d) comparison with terpene characteristics of other cultivars. The content of free- and bound-terpens was determined using the GAS chromatography method. For both cultivars was characteristic good aromatic properties, but with high level of citronellol, especially as free citronellol. The environment interaction has noted influence for both cultivars to development of terpenic compounds.
